Fashion Is a Battlefield

In the premiere episode, the country’s most talented up-and-coming designers are sent straight to the fashion front lines. Host Iman and Mentor Brian Bailey greet the designers at the Canadian War Museum and deliver the first challenge. Drama ensues when two designers face the toughest – and most surprising challenge of their fashion careers. It’s a race against time as the designers prepare to show their first creations at a special, public runway show. Joe Zee, Creative Director of U.S. ELLE magazine, joins the judging panel, which declares the season’s first challenge winner and the first eliminated designer.

Claim to Fame

On the runway, Iman surprises the designers by introducing their special celebrity muse - Canadian sweetheart and Hollywood A-list celebrity Elisha Cuthbert. The opportunity to dress a celebrity can make or break a new designer and the tension causes some designers to crack under the pressure. Elisha Cuthbert joins the judges and selects the winning outfit she will wear on a night out in Hollywood. As always, one designer doesn’t measure up and is sent packing. Canadian actress Elisha Cuthbert burst onto the American scene as Kiefer Sutherland’s daughter, "Kimberly Bauer," in the critically acclaimed FOX/Global series 24. Cuthbert’s portrayal earned her a nomination for a 2002 Teen Choice Award for "Breakout TV Actress." She also received a 2005 SAG Nomination as part of the 24 cast in the category of “Outstanding Performance by an Ensemble in a Drama Series.” Cuthbert will soon be seen in the romantic dramedy, My Sassy Girl.

Fashion History

The designers’ creative skills and knowledge of fashion history is put to the test. Working in teams of three, they must create a couture collection inspired by an iconic fashion house. The designers learn that their fabric for this challenge has a history, too. Iman makes a surprise trip to the workroom and shares her experiences of working with the greatest names in fashion. Iconic designer Wayne Clark joins the judging panel to declare a winner and send another designer home. With nearly 30 years of experience in the fashion industry, Wayne Clark has created a brand that is synonymous with glamour and luxury. He studied at Sheridan College and apprenticed with Hardy Amies and Ossie Clark in London, England. Wayne Clark returned to Toronto in the late ’70’s where he began his own collection and the legend was born. Wayne Clark’s gowns are sold around the world and have been worn by celebrities as diverse as Jane Fonda, Cindy Crawford and Vivica A. Fox

60 Minutes

60 Minutes has been on the air since 1968, beginning on a Tuesday, but spending most of its time on Sundays, where it remains today. This popular news magazine provides both hard hitting investigations, interviews and features, along with people in the news and current events. 60 Minutes has set unprecedented records in the Nielsen's ratings with a number 1 rating, five times, making it among the most successful TV programs in all of television history. This series has won more Emmy awards than any other news program and in 2003, Don Hewitt, the creator (back in 1968), was awarded the Lifetime Achievement Emmy, along with the 60 Minute correspondents. Added to the 11 Peabody awards, this phenomenally long-lived series has collected 78 awards up to the 2005 season and remains among the viewers top choice for news magazine features.
